数控编程零基础学什么好
-
数控编程是一门需要掌握一定基础知识和技能的技术,对于零基础的学习者来说,以下几个方面是需要学习的重点:
-
数学基础:数控编程需要进行一些数学计算和运算,因此学习者需要具备一定的数学基础,包括数学运算、几何知识和三角函数等。
-
机械基础:数控编程与机械加工密切相关,学习者需要了解机械基础知识,包括机械结构、机械加工原理和工具等。
-
材料知识:了解不同材料的性质和特点,对于数控编程来说是很重要的,因为不同材料的切削参数和刀具选择都会有所不同。
-
CAD/CAM软件:学习者需要掌握一种或多种CAD/CAM软件,例如AutoCAD、MasterCAM等,这些软件是进行数控编程的必备工具。
-
G代码和M代码:学习者需要了解G代码和M代码的基本语法和编程规则,这是数控编程的核心部分。
-
实践经验:学习者需要通过实践来提高自己的编程能力,可以通过模拟编程、实际加工等方式进行练习和实践。
总之,对于零基础的学习者来说,数学基础、机械基础、材料知识、CAD/CAM软件的掌握以及对G代码和M代码的理解都是学习数控编程的基础。通过系统学习和实践,不断提升自己的编程能力,就能够逐渐掌握数控编程技术。
1年前 -
-
学习数控编程需要从零基础开始,以下是学习数控编程的一些建议:
-
数控基础知识:了解数控机床的基本原理、结构和工作方式,学习数控编程的基本术语和概念,掌握数控编程中常用的坐标系和刀具补偿等基本操作。
-
G代码和M代码:G代码是数控编程中控制机床运动的代码,M代码是控制机床辅助功能的代码。学习常用的G代码和M代码,掌握它们的功能和使用方法,能够根据加工要求编写简单的数控程序。
-
CAD/CAM软件:学习使用CAD软件绘制零件图形,掌握CAD软件的基本操作和绘图技巧。学习使用CAM软件进行数控编程,包括生成数控刀具路径、选择加工策略、设置加工参数等。
-
数控刀具和刀具路径优化:了解不同类型的数控刀具,学习选择合适的刀具进行加工,并了解刀具的使用和维护。学习优化刀具路径,减少加工时间和提高加工质量。
-
实践操作和问题解决:通过实际操作数控机床进行编程和加工,积累经验和技巧。遇到问题时,学会分析和解决问题,提高自己的问题解决能力。
此外,还可以通过参加培训班、阅读相关教材和参考资料,以及与经验丰富的数控编程人员交流,加快学习进度和提高技能水平。
1年前 -
-
对于零基础学习数控编程,以下是一些建议:
-
数控编程基础知识
首先,你需要了解数控编程的基础知识,包括数控机床的基本组成、数控编程的基本原理、数控编程中常用的指令和编程格式等。可以通过阅读相关的书籍、网络教程或者参加培训课程来学习。 -
数学知识
数控编程涉及到一些数学知识,如几何图形、坐标系、向量等,因此你需要对基本的数学知识有一定的了解。如果对数学知识有所欠缺,可以通过学习相关的数学课程来提升自己的数学水平。 -
CAD软件
数控编程通常需要使用CAD软件来绘制零件的图形,并进行相应的编辑和修正。因此,你需要学习一些常用的CAD软件,如AutoCAD、Solidworks等。可以通过自学、参加培训课程或者在线教程来学习。 -
CAM软件
CAM软件是数控编程中非常重要的工具,它可以将CAD图形转化为数控机床可以识别和执行的指令。因此,你需要学习一些常用的CAM软件,如Mastercam、PowerMill等。可以通过自学、参加培训课程或者在线教程来学习。 -
编程语言
数控编程通常使用的是G代码和M代码,这是一种特定的编程语言,用于控制数控机床的运动和操作。你需要学习这些编程语言的基本语法和规则,以及常用的指令和函数。可以通过阅读相关的书籍、参加培训课程或者在线教程来学习。 -
实践操作
学习数控编程最重要的是进行实践操作,通过编写和调试程序来提升自己的编程能力。可以通过在数控机床上进行实际加工操作,或者使用数控仿真软件进行虚拟加工来进行实践操作。
总之,数控编程是一门需要不断学习和实践的技术,零基础学习数控编程需要掌握数控编程基础知识、数学知识、CAD软件、CAM软件、编程语言等方面的知识,并进行实践操作来提升自己的编程能力。
1年前 -